Welcome to 2017!! I hope your holiday was great and you enjoyed spending time with family and friends! I have a few friendly reminders that will help us get through the rest of this school year. Parents please remember that the 21st Century is a Free Program for students that benefit from a variety of stimulating personal enrichment activities that promote school success and well-being in a safe environment. Active attendance and engagement are essential to the students and programs success.

All students must attend until 5:45 PM!! If for any reason your child is absent or leaving earlier than 5:45 PM you MUST send a note! Also, Parents must attend at least 2 Family Events during the school year. Family Events are held once a month!

Lack of participation will result in termination from the program. Monday, January 16, 2016 we will be closed in observance of Martin Luther King Jr. Holiday. Please be sure to check the parent table for new and updated information.

Sole HopeOur students will be making slippers out of old jeans through the (Sole Hope) program for the less fortunate children in Africa. Them not having shoes has caused foot disease and poor education issues.

Brain Teaser --- 10 QuestionsThe questions posed are fun and challenging. The students enjoy working on them individually or in small groups.1. How many birthdays does an average person have? 2. Do they have a fourth of July in England?3. Why can’t a man living in New York be buried west

of the Mississippi River?4. If you only had one match, and entered a room

where there was a kerosene lamp, an oil heater and some kindling wood, which would you, light first?

5. Some months have thirty days and some have thirty-one days. How many months have twenty eight days?

6. How many outs are there in each inning of a baseball game?

7. Divide 30 by ½ and add 10. What is the answer?8. I have in my hand two U.S. coins which total 55

cents. One is not a nickel. Please keep that in mind. What are the two coins?

9. How far can a dog run into the woods?10. A farmer had seventeen sheep. All but nine ran

away. How many did he have left?

Answer Key:

1. Only 1 – everyone is born once, but celebrates yearly.

2. Yes, they have the fourth day in July in all countries.

3. He can’t be buried because he’s still alive.

4. You must light the match first.5. All months have 28 days. 6. Six outs, three for each team7. 70. 30 divided by ½ is 60, plus 10

is 70.8. A nickel and a half-dollar. One

coin is not a nickel, but the other is!

9. Half way. After that, the dog is running out of the woods.

10. He had nine left!
